WebA moderate or severe TBI is caused by a bump, blow, or jolt to the head or by a penetrating injury (such as from a gunshot) to the head.In the United States, severe TBIs are linked to thousands of deaths each year. 1 For those who survive, a moderate or severe TBI may lead to long-term or life-long health problems that may affect all aspects of a person’s life.

WebA traumatic brain injury (TBI) can happen when an external force causes severe damage to the brain. A traumatic brain injury, or TBI, is an injury that affects how the brain works. TBI is a major cause of death and disability … closing of cervixWebOct 3, 2024 · A traumatic brain injury (TBI) is a disruption of the normal function of the brain that can be caused by a bump, blow or jolt to the head or a penetrating head injury. While everyone is at risk for a TBI, children and older adults are especially vulnerable.
